Matchup Analysis

European Pro League Group B stage raises the stakes for both sides

Noir Esports and Team Spirit Academy meet in a Group B best-of-three in European Pro League Season 38, a format that places a premium on deeper hero pools, draft flexibility, and the ability to adjust over multiple maps.

Team Spirit Academy lean on the structure of a major Dota 2 organization

Team Spirit Academy enter as the developmental Dota 2 squad of the Team Spirit organization, benefiting from the infrastructure, coaching pipeline, and practice environment of a club that already fields a flagship Dota 2 roster at the highest level.

Macro discipline versus high-variance skirmishing as a likely stylistic clash

In the EU/CIS tier-two environment, academy teams often emphasize structured macro play and objective trading, whereas hungry independent stacks are more inclined toward tempo-heavy, skirmish-oriented drafts, so the early drafts should reveal whether Team Spirit Academy aim to slow Noir down or are willing to brawl on their terms.
